Get the minimum value in the SortedSet as defined by the comparer in CSharp

Description

The following code shows how to get the minimum value in the SortedSet as defined by the comparer.

Example

using System;
using System.Collections.Generic;

public class MainClass{
  public static void Main(String[] argv){  
    SortedSet<int> evenNumbers = new SortedSet<int>();
    for (int i = 0; i < 5; i++)
    {
        evenNumbers.Add(i * 2);
    }
    Console.WriteLine(evenNumbers.Min);
  }
}
